Transaction 33e1e7fac9684bd165d577c02786b521c410146e097934b4396ffae6e4f7467a

2 Input
2 Outputs
  • 33e1e7fac9684bd165d577c02786b521c410146e097934b4396ffae6e4f7467a:0
  • value  2521577906
    address  17tohZ6eZApcua3SeRQcbXMiQCCW5aYn34
  • 33e1e7fac9684bd165d577c02786b521c410146e097934b4396ffae6e4f7467a:1
  • value  500226479
    address  3BPLfQUuYNqqYVpKdKgGSdwvwh2K13c39H